What are the eligibility criteria for the Kerala PSC KAS exam?
The eligibility for the KPSC KAS exam is based on two main factors:
-
Kerala PSC Academic Qualification
-
Kerala PSC Age Limit
You can learn more about the Kerala PSC KAS Eligibility in the table below:
Kerala PSC Eligibility
|
KAS Exam – Academic Qualification
|
For the following posts:
-
Stream-1 Post
-
Stream-2 Post
-
Stream-3 Post
|
The candidate must possess a Bachelor's Degree, including a professional course in any subject from a University recognized by a University established by Kerala Government or UGC or awarded by National Institutes established by the Government of India.
|
Kerala PSC – Age Limit
|
Stream-1 Post
|
Minimum Age – 21
Maximum Age – 32
(For candidates born between 02.01.1987 and 01.01.1998)
|
Stream-2 Post
|
Minimum Age – 21
Maximum Age – 40
(For candidates born between 02.01.1979 and 01.01.1998)
|
Stream-3 Post
|
The candidate must not have reached 50 years of age on the 1st January of the exam year.

Kerala PSC KAS – Age Relaxation
The conditions for age relaxation for the Kerala Administrative Exam are as follows:
Kerala PSC KAS Age Relaxation
|
OBC
|
3 years
|
SC & ST
|
5 years
|
Widows
|
5 years
|
Differently-abled (vision, hearing, speech)
|
15 years
|
Orthopaedically differently-abled
|
10 years
|
Ex-Servicemen
|
The maximum age limit will be relaxed to the extent of the period of service put in by them in the Defence Forces and the period of unemployment on discharge up to a maximum of five years.
